GPA Wins NBR May Day Sports

africa » gambia
Wednesday, May 13, 2009

Having successfully secured 126 points on Saturday, GPA was crowned winner of the second edition of the North Bank Region May Day Sports.

Last year's third place holders claimed  the mantle of leadership after sailing past notable sides like Gamtel,  Nawec and last year's winners and runners up Education and  Interior.

Nawec finished second with 115 points, Education third with 76, Gamtel fourth with 73.

Gambia Armed Forces came out 5th with 68 points.

ADWAC, GTB. NEA, Governor's Office, Kerewan Area Council, Gampost and Forestry each recorded 62,61,41,25 17, 6 and 2 points respectively.
